There are things called "Scat Mats" that you can put on your couch, and when your pup jumps on the couch, it makes a beeping noise and scares them.
Or, you can buy the clear plastic runners that have the pointed prickers thingies on the underside to keep it from moving on your carpet. Buy those and turn them upside down on your couch and it is not comfortable for the pup at all when he/she jumps up.
I know tin foil works with cats, I don't know about dogs. (them not liking the feeling)
You could try sprays they have at the pet store, my in laws have used "No" I think it was by Harts. You spray it on a rag, and put the rag where you want your animals to stay away from. Pet stores would carry a few different types of things like that.
My inlaws used to take the cushions off the couch when they would leave the house to make sure the dog was not sleeping on the couch. (she still would, there were just no cushions to sleep on!)
